The Ministry of Information and Broadcasting (I&B Ministry) has issued an advisory/advisory on television commercials for online gaming and fantasy sports in all private satellite TV channels on 4 December 2020. This advice instructs advertisers to provide appropriate disclaimers that clearly state that such sports involve financial risks and that no one under 18 should participate. This guideline will come into effect from December 15, 2020. PM Modi Inaugurates Construction Of Agra Metro Rail Project
Prime Minister Narendra Modi inaugurated the construction work of the Agra Metro Rail Project through virtual means on 07 December 2020. This project with two corridors will help the tourists. Through this project, tourist spots like Taj Mahal, Agra Fort, Sikandra will be connected to the railway station and bus stand. Inauguration program was done at Agra’s 15 battalion PAC Parade Ground. This project will make life easier for the people of Agra and will also be helpful for the tourists coming to Agra. Indian Navy Discovers Body Of Crashed MiG-29K’s Missing Pilot Commander Nishant Singh
After nearly 11 days of hard work, the Indian Navy discovered the body of Commander Nishant Singh. His body was found at a depth of 70 meters from the surface, about 30 miles off the coast of Goa. The navy had united day and night in this search operation. State-of-the-art resources were used for search and rescue. Commander Nishant Singh was missing since 26 November after his MiG-29K crashed into the Arabian Sea while a pilot was rescued. China Deploys Combat aircraft and soldiers deployed near Gujarat border
The ongoing dispute between the two countries on the Indo-China border in eastern Ladakh is yet to calm down and China has again started showing its colour. China has now planned to conduct military exercises with Pakistan’s military and for this it has sent combat aircraft and troops to the Pakistani airbase near the Gujarat border. The People’s Liberation Army has said in its statement that Chinese airmen have flown to the airbase of the Pakistani Air Force located at Bholari, Pakistan to participate in the exercise Shaheen (Eagle) IX. Army gets approval for the post of third deputy chief
The government has approved the post of the third deputy chief to the Army. According to sources, under this, the government has issued a government statement letter. This third term will be as Deputy Chief (Strategy). Both the DGMO (Director General of Military Operations) and DGMI (ie Military Intelligence) departments will work under the head of the Army. All the operations and military-planning of the army will now be their responsibility. Keeping in mind the present-day high-warfare and social-media, a new unit, DG (IW) has been formed by joining together the media wing of the Army, ADGPI and IW (Info-Warfare).
PoK’s two sisters accidentally reached Poonch, Indian Army sent back with gifts and sweets
The Indian Army has once again set an example for humanity. In fact, two sisters of Pakistan-occupied Kashmir (PoK) accidentally crossed the border into Poonch district of Jammu and Kashmir on Sunday and sent them back with gifts and sweets from the army camp. Army officials said that they both accidentally crossed the Line of Control and reached Poonch district of Jammu and Kashmir. According to the Indian Army, Laba Jabair (17) and his sister Sana Jabair (13) were spotted by Indian soldiers wandering across the Line of Control on Sunday and took them into custody.
